Naledi Pandor Applaud Catholic Church Community Centre in Madidi

by Phuti Makgabo | Aug 16, 2018 | Caritas, Ikhanya News, Social Action

  It will probably be a long time before the people of Madidi in the North West Province see the Minister of Higher Education and Training again, but they are hoping that her visit on the 14 of August 2018 will bring about more positive changes to the community....

Catholic Bishops Discuss Land Issue

by Phuti Makgabo | Aug 16, 2018 | Bishop Statements, Ikhanya News, Social Action

A Cry to the Beloved Country Meeting the Challenge of Land  A Statement by the Southern African Catholic Bishops Conference Urgency of the Land Issue It is widely accepted that the matter of land ownership in South Africa calls for urgent attention. The consultations...
